It’s stiff—Classics-racing stiff—and performs like you’d want a road bike to perform off-road. We think that makes sense, and it’s what we were trying to do when we were stuffing bigger tires into our existing frames and swapping in aftermarket forks to get a 40mm tire up front.
The flip-chip in the fork—we call it the Trail Mixer—keeps the trail measurement consistent whether you choose 700c or 650b tires. This maintains the bike’s personality and handling characteristics when you switch from mid-fats to full-fat. STACK | 505MM | 530MM | 555MM | 580MM | 605MM | 630MM |
REACH | 370MM | 379MM | 388MM | 397MM | 406MM | 415MM |
SEAT TUBE ANGLE | 74.5° | 74° | 73.5° | 73° | 73° | 73° |
TOP TUBE LENGTH | 512MM | 532MM | 553MM | 575MM | 591MM | 608MM |
WHEEL SIZE | 700C | 700C | 700C | 700C | 700C | 700C |
HEAD TUBE ANGLE | 71° | 71.5° | 72° | 72° | 72° | 72° |
TRAIL * | 58.6(700C) / 58.1(650B)MM | 58.6(700C) / 58.1(650B)MM | 58.6(700C) / 58.1(650B)MM | 58.6(700C) / 58.1(650B)MM | 58.6(700C) / 58.1(650B)MM | 58.6(700C) / 58.1(650B)MM |
FORK OFFSET | 52/57MM | 49/54MM | 46/51MM | 46/51MM | 46/51MM | 46/51MM |
HEAD TUBE LENGTH | 83MM | 107MM | 133MM | 159MM | 188MM | 214MM |
BOTTOM BRACKET DROP | 78.5MM | 78.5MM | 76MM | 76MM | 73.5MM | 73.5MM |
FRONT CENTER | 583MM | 592MM | 602MM | 619MM | 637MM | 654MM |
WHEELBASE | 990MM | 1000MM | 1010MM | 1027MM | 1046MM | 1063MM |
STANDOVER HEIGHT | 690MM | 732MM | 764MM | 788MM | 814MM | 838MM |
CHAINSTAY LENGTH | 420MM | 420MM | 420MM | 420MM | 420MM | 420MM |
